site stats

Polygon line intersection algorithm

WebScan Line Algorithm. This algorithm works by intersecting scanline with polygon edges and fills the polygon between pairs of intersections. The following steps depict how this … WebDDA is an algorithm that used to generate a line in 3D space and in ray tracing traversal 3D- ... each cell id that intersect the polygon with po-lygon index itself.

Sweep-Line Algorithm for Line Segment Intersection (3/5 ... - YouTube

WebApr 7, 2016 · I have a collection of non-self-overlapping simple polygons P. In actuality, they are 2D triangles in 3D-space. I'm looking for a data structure which, given a line L, has a … WebOct 1, 1982 · given graph be a possibly self-intersecting polygon, i.e., a closed chain of n line segments or equivalently, a cyclic list of n points in the plane (for an application of self- citizens legal assistance office https://askerova-bc.com

Polygon Filling Algorithm - TutorialsPoint

WebPolygon triangulation. In computational geometry, polygon triangulation is the partition of a polygonal area ( simple polygon) P into a set of triangles, [1] i.e., finding a set of triangles with pairwise non-intersecting interiors whose union is P . Triangulations may be viewed as special cases of planar straight-line graphs. Web• Claim: Intersection of two convex polygons P and Q has complexity O( P + Q ) • Algorithm outline • choose edge A on P, B on Q arbitrarily • repeat • if A intersects B • print … WebFortunately, NTS is sensitive to robustness problems in only a few key functions (such as line intersection and the point-in-polygon test). There are efficient robust algorithms … citizen sleeper shipmind core

Finding if two polygons intersect in Python

Category:Line Intersection using Bentley Ottmann Algorithm - HackerEarth

Tags:Polygon line intersection algorithm

Polygon line intersection algorithm

algorithms - Data structure for determining intersection between …

WebFeb 15, 2010 · Compute the center of mass for each polygon. Compute the min or max or average distance from each point of the polygon to the center of mass. If C1C2 (where … WebApr 1, 2001 · The convex deficiency tree (CDT) algorithm described in this paper constructslean set representations of curved two-dimensional polygons automatically for …

Polygon line intersection algorithm

Did you know?

WebAug 12, 2024 · Solution 2. The Shamos-Hoey algorithm is designed for the task of simply reporting whether a polygon has self-intersections or not. There is an excellent writeup in … WebOct 1, 1998 · Section snippets Intersection of segment-polygon in 2D. The problem of the determination between polygons and segments of line may be expressed on the following …

WebAug 1, 2024 · In Sympy, the function Polygon.intersection () is used to get the intersection of a given polygon and the given geometry entity. The geometry entity can be a point, line, … WebSep 30, 2024 · An Algorithm for Polygon Intersections. In this post we'll work our way towards an algorithm that can compute convex polygon intersections. We'll also a …

WebMar 24, 2024 · Polygon Intersection. Download Wolfram Notebook. The problem of polygon intersection seeks to determine if two polygons intersect and, if so, possibly determine … WebThere are many different algorithms to determine if a point is inside or outside the polygon. We will use the modified "ray intersection" algorithm. The basic idea of the algorithm: Shoot a ray from plane intersection point in arbitrary direction in plane and count the number of line segments crossed.

WebJul 15, 2024 · In other words - we should check all possible lines (combination of any 2 points) in polygon for a possible intersection. Check whenever any combination of 2 lines …

WebOct 31, 2024 · The algorithm can also be adapted to answer similar questions, such as the total perimeter length of the union or the maximum number of rectangles that overlap at … dickies cyber mondayWebJun 12, 2015 · From your drawings and the comments I think your requirements are that the line. intersects with the interior of the polygon; does not just touch the boundary of the polygon; Just combine the requirements. This is the … dickies cutoff cargo pantWebAbstractThe intersection ofN halfplanes is a basic problem in computational geometry and computer graphics. The optimal offline algorithm for this problem runs in timeO(N logN). In this paper, an optimal online algorithm which runs also in timeO(N logN) ... dickies daily lunch specialsWebThe Algorithm Briefly... Let P and Q be two convex polygons whose intersection is a convex polygon.The algorithm for finding this convex intersection polygon can be described by these three steps: . Construct … dickies dalton safety bootWebRay-Polygon Intersection. A ray is only defined for t ≥ 0, so we can simply check if t is nonnegative, and accept or reject the intersection.. Line Segment–Polygon Intersection. We assume a line segment is represented by a pair of points {P 0, P 1}.We can again employ a similar algorithm for line-polygon intersection by converting the line segment into ray form. citizens lending group lancsterWebMar 19, 2014 · I'm looking for an algorithm, a high-level solution, or even a library which can help me determine if two polygons intersect, in Python. I have the vertices of the two polygons (These are single-part polygons without any holes) in two different arrays. The polygons are 2D (i.e. just X and Y coordinates) citizens lending group sell mortgatesWebIn computational geometry, a sweep line algorithm or plane sweep algorithm is an algorithmic paradigm that uses a conceptual sweep line or sweep surface to solve various problems in Euclidean space.It is one of the critical techniques in computational geometry. The idea behind algorithms of this type is to imagine that a line (often a vertical line) is … citizens letterhead